Technical Specifications
Side-by-side comparison of Xeon Gold 5217 and Ryzen 7 1700X

Xeon Gold 5217
The Xeon Gold 5217 is manufactured by Intel. It was released in 2 April 2019 (6 years ago). It is based on the Cascade Lake (2019−2020) architecture. It features 8 cores and 16 threads. Base frequency is 3 GHz, with boost up to 3.7 GHz. L3 cache: 11 MB. L2 cache: 8 MB. Built on 14 nm process technology. Socket: LGA3647. Thermal design power (TDP): 115 Watt. Memory support: DDR4-2667. Passmark benchmark score: 15,429 points. Launch price was $1,522.

Ryzen 7 1700X
The Ryzen 7 1700X is manufactured by AMD. It was released in 2 March 2017 (8 years ago). It is based on the Zen (2017−2020) architecture. It features 8 cores and 16 threads. Base frequency is 3.4 GHz, with boost up to 3.8 GHz. L3 cache: 16384 kB. L2 cache: 4096 kB. Built on 14 nm process technology. Socket: AM4. Thermal design power (TDP): 95 Watt. Memory support: DDR4. Passmark benchmark score: 15,623 points. Launch price was $399.
Processing Power
Both the Xeon Gold 5217 and Ryzen 7 1700X share an identical 8-core/16-thread configuration. Boost clocks reach 3.7 GHz on the Xeon Gold 5217 versus 3.8 GHz on the Ryzen 7 1700X — a 2.7% clock advantage for the Ryzen 7 1700X (base: 3 GHz vs 3.4 GHz). The Xeon Gold 5217 uses the Cascade Lake (2019−2020) architecture (14 nm), while the Ryzen 7 1700X uses Zen (2017−2020) (14 nm). In PassMark, the Xeon Gold 5217 scores 15,429 against the Ryzen 7 1700X's 15,623 — a 1.2% lead for the Ryzen 7 1700X. L3 cache: 11 MB on the Xeon Gold 5217 vs 16384 kB on the Ryzen 7 1700X.

Memory & Platform
The Xeon Gold 5217 uses the LGA3647 socket (PCIe 3.0), while the Ryzen 7 1700X uses AM4 (PCIe 3.0) — making them incompatible on the same motherboard. Both support up to DDR4-2667 memory speed. The Xeon Gold 5217 supports up to 1024 GB of RAM compared to 128 GB — 155.6% more capacity for professional workloads. Memory channels: 6 (Xeon Gold 5217) vs 2 (Ryzen 7 1700X). PCIe lanes: 48 (Xeon Gold 5217) vs 24 (Ryzen 7 1700X) — the Xeon Gold 5217 offers 24 more lanes for additional GPUs or NVMe drives. Chipset compatibility: C621,C622,C624,C627,C628 (Xeon Gold 5217) and AMD 400 series,AMD 300 series (Ryzen 7 1700X).
